Tesco Bank now provides a wide array of banking services, as well as car, home, pet and travel insurance.
It offers several car insurance policies: Bronze, Silver, Gold and Cover Plus, as well as black box insurance for younger drivers aged between 17 and 35.
We've reviewed the first four policies. Its car insurance is underwritten by Tesco Underwriting.

Tesco Bank's standard Silver policy scored of 62% – just below the average policy score of 64%.
The policy offers a guaranteed courtesy car for the duration of repairs as well as comprehensive cover for overseas driving for up to 90 days as standard.
However, it lacked cover for misfuelling (putting the wrong fuel n your car) and doesn't cover damaged or lost car keys as many policies do.
If your car is hit by an uninsured driver, you won't be penalised provided you have the other driver's details.
As soon as Tesco Bank validates the details of the incident (including the other vehicle's make, model and registration number), your no-claims discount will be reinstated.
Tesco's Bronze policy – which strips out features such as cover for driving other cars and for your car's windscreen and windows – was one of the lowest-scoring in our assessment, earning a score of just 51%.
It's premium Gold policy scored 76%, ranking fourth out of 61 policies. Cover Plus did slightly better than Silver with a score of 63%, but was still below average.

We asked Tesco Bank customers who have recently made a claim how they felt about their car insurance.
Tesco Bank achieved an underwhelming 63% customer score, which is just below the average of 64%.
Customers were also asked to rate their most recent claim. Tesco earned a middling claims score of 64% – the same as the average (also 64%) and 14th out of 25 companies scored on claims.

Tesco Bank's Gold policy is only available direct (on its website or by phone). The other three policies can also be purchased via the following price comparison websites:
Tesco doesn't offer discounts for purchasing multiple products or multiple policies. However, Clubcard members can get discounts.
